&lt;p&gt;&lt;b&gt;New page&lt;/b&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;div&gt;## Focusing on Specific Mistakes &amp;amp; Emotional Triggers in Crypto Futures Trading&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Navigating the world of crypto futures trading, particularly with high leverage, demands more than just technical analysis and market understanding. It requires a deep understanding of *yourself* – your tendencies, your emotional triggers, and the specific mistakes *you* are prone to making. This article will identifying these personal pitfalls, establishing discipline through daily habits, and utilizing self-audit techniques to improve your trading psychology.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
### The Emotional Minefield of High-Leverage Futures&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
High leverage amplifies both profits *and* losses. This magnification creates a fertile ground for emotional trading, where rational decision-making is superseded by fear, greed, and hope. These emotions can lead to devastating results, even for traders with sound strategies. &l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Here are some common emotional pitfalls:&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
* **Fear of Missing Out (FOMO):** Jumping into a trade because you see others profiting, without proper analysis.&lt;br /&gt;
* **Revenge Trading:** Attempting to quickly recoup losses with reckless trades, often increasing leverage beyond your risk tolerance.&lt;br /&gt;
* **Greed:** Holding onto a winning trade for too long, hoping for even greater profits, and ultimately giving back gains.&lt;br /&gt;
* **Panic Selling:** Exiting a trade prematurely during a temporary dip, driven by fear of further losses.&lt;br /&gt;
* **Overconfidence:** A string of wins leading to a belief in infallibility and a disregard for risk management.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;

### Identifying Your Specific Mistakes&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Generic advice about emotional control is helpful, but truly impactful improvement comes from pinpointing *your* specific weaknesses. Here’s how:&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
* **Trade Journaling:** This is paramount. Record *every* trade, including:&lt;br /&gt;
 * Date and Time&lt;br /&gt;
 * Crypto Pair&lt;br /&gt;
 * Entry and Exit Prices&lt;br /&gt;
 * Leverage Used&lt;br /&gt;
 * Position Size&lt;br /&gt;
 * Rationale for the Trade (technical analysis, news event, etc.)&lt;br /&gt;
 * **Emotional State Before, During, and After the Trade:** Be brutally honest. Were you anxious? Excited? Did you feel pressured?&lt;br /&gt;
 * Outcome (Profit/Loss)&lt;br /&gt;
 * Lessons Learned&lt;br /&gt;
* **Reviewing Past Trades:** Regularly (weekly/monthly) review your trade journal. Look for patterns. What situations consistently lead to losses? What emotions were present during those losing trades?&lt;br /&gt;
* **Backtesting with Emotional Notes:** When backtesting a strategy, don’t just focus on the numbers. Imagine yourself executing the trades *in real-time*. How would you *feel* at each stage? This helps identify potential emotional vulnerabilities.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;

### Daily Habits for Emotional Discipline&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Building emotional resilience isn&amp;#039;t a one-time fix; it requires consistent effort and the incorporation of disciplined habits:&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
* **Pre-Trading Routine:** Establish a routine *before* you start trading. This could include meditation, exercise, or simply reviewing your trading plan.&lt;br /&gt;
* **Defined Trading Plan:** Have a clear plan for each trade, including entry and exit points, stop-loss orders, and position size. Stick to the plan!&lt;br /&gt;
* **Risk Management Rules:** Never risk more than a predetermined percentage of your capital on a single trade (e.g., 1-2%). Use stop-loss orders religiously.&lt;br /&gt;
* **Timeboxing:** Allocate specific time blocks for trading. Avoid prolonged exposure to the market.&lt;br /&gt;
* **Regular Breaks:** Step away from the screen regularly to clear your head and reduce stress.&lt;br /&gt;
* **Physical Well-being:** Prioritize sleep, healthy eating, and exercise. These contribute significantly to emotional stability.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
### Self-Audit Techniques &amp;amp; Psychology Checklists&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Regular self-assessment is crucial for maintaining discipline. Here are some techniques:&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
* **The &amp;quot;Five Whys&amp;quot;:** When you experience a negative outcome, ask yourself &amp;quot;Why?&amp;quot; five times to get to the root cause. For example:&lt;br /&gt;
 1. Why did I close the trade prematurely? (Because I was scared the price would drop further.)&lt;br /&gt;
 2. Why was I scared the price would drop further? (Because I hadn&amp;#039;t set a stop-loss.)&lt;br /&gt;
 3. Why hadn&amp;#039;t I set a stop-loss? (Because I was overconfident.)&lt;br /&gt;
 4. Why was I overconfident? (Because I had a few winning trades in a row.)&lt;br /&gt;
 5. Why did those winning trades make me overconfident? (Because I didn&amp;#039;t acknowledge the role of luck.)&lt;br /&gt;
* **Emotional Trigger Log:** Keep a separate log specifically for identifying your emotional triggers. What market conditions, news events, or personal circumstances tend to evoke strong emotional responses?&lt;br /&gt;
* **Psychology Checklist (Example):**&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
{| class=&amp;quot;wikitable&amp;quot;&lt;br /&gt;
! Emotion !! Trigger !! Mitigation Technique&lt;br /&gt;
|-&lt;br /&gt;
| Panic Sell || Sharp drop || Use trailing stop, pre-defined exit rules&lt;br /&gt;
| Fear of Missing Out (FOMO) || Price surge || Stick to trading plan, avoid impulsive entries&lt;br /&gt;
| Revenge Trading || Recent Loss || Take a break, review trading plan, reduce position size&lt;br /&gt;
| Overconfidence || Winning Streak || Revisit risk management rules, acknowledge luck&lt;br /&gt;
| Greed || Profitable Trade || Set profit targets, take partial profits, move stop-loss to break-even&lt;br /&gt;
|}&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
